Hi,

Here is a new attempt at getting the MMC controllers running, following the
work done by Andre.

This has been tested on a board with one SDIO device (a Marvell WiFi chip)
and a Kingston eMMC with 1.8V IOs.

For SDIO, the HS DDR mode works just fine. That serie also enables the
SDR104 mode to work on the devices that are capable of this.

For the eMMC, HS200 with the voltage switch works. HS400 doesn't at the
moment, but since it's significantly more complex, and at the same time
Allwinner recommends to limit its frequency to 100MHz, this doesn't have
any benefits. If there's any at some point, this can be added later.

* [PATCH v5 1/13] mmc: sunxi: Fix clock frequency change sequence
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

The SD specification documents that the clock frequency should only be
changed once gated (Section 3.2.3 - SD Clock Frequency Change Sequence).

The current code first modifies the parent clock, gates it and then
modifies the internal divider. This means that since the parent clock rate
might be changed, the bus clock might be changed as well before it is
gated, which breaks the specification.

Move the gating before the parent rate modification.

Signed-off-by: Maxime Ripard <maxime.ripard@free-electrons.com>
Tested-by: Florian Vaussard <florian.vaussard@heig-vd.ch>
---
 drivers/mmc/host/sunxi-mmc.c | 8 ++++----
 1 file changed, 4 insertions(+), 4 deletions(-)

diff --git a/drivers/mmc/host/sunxi-mmc.c b/drivers/mmc/host/sunxi-mmc.c
index b1d1303389a7..ab4324e6eb74 100644
--- a/drivers/mmc/host/sunxi-mmc.c
+++ b/drivers/mmc/host/sunxi-mmc.c
@@ -761,6 +761,10 @@ static int sunxi_mmc_clk_set_rate(struct sunxi_mmc_host *host,
 	u32 rval, clock = ios->clock;
 	int ret;
 
+	ret = sunxi_mmc_oclk_onoff(host, 0);
+	if (ret)
+		return ret;
+
 	/* 8 bit DDR requires a higher module clock */
 	if (ios->timing == MMC_TIMING_MMC_DDR52 &&
 	    ios->bus_width == MMC_BUS_WIDTH_8)
@@ -783,10 +787,6 @@ static int sunxi_mmc_clk_set_rate(struct sunxi_mmc_host *host,
 		return ret;
 	}
 
-	ret = sunxi_mmc_oclk_onoff(host, 0);
-	if (ret)
-		return ret;
-
 	/* clear internal divider */
 	rval = mmc_readl(host, REG_CLKCR);
 	rval &= ~0xff;

* [PATCH v5 3/13] mmc: sunxi: Always set signal delay to 0 for A64
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

Experience have shown that the using the  autocalibration could severely
degrade the performances of the MMC bus.

Allwinner is using in its BSP a delay set to 0 for all the modes but HS400.
Remove the calibration code for now, and add comments to document our
findings.

Reviewed-by: Andre Przywara <andre.przywara@arm.com>
Signed-off-by: Maxime Ripard <maxime.ripard@free-electrons.com>
Tested-by: Florian Vaussard <florian.vaussard@heig-vd.ch>
---
 drivers/mmc/host/sunxi-mmc.c | 50 ++++++++++++-------------------------
 1 file changed, 17 insertions(+), 33 deletions(-)

diff --git a/drivers/mmc/host/sunxi-mmc.c b/drivers/mmc/host/sunxi-mmc.c
index 019f95e8e7c5..b9c8a62bc212 100644
--- a/drivers/mmc/host/sunxi-mmc.c
+++ b/drivers/mmc/host/sunxi-mmc.c
@@ -683,41 +683,19 @@ static int sunxi_mmc_oclk_onoff(struct sunxi_mmc_host *host, u32 oclk_en)
 
 static int sunxi_mmc_calibrate(struct sunxi_mmc_host *host, int reg_off)
 {
-	u32 reg = readl(host->reg_base + reg_off);
-	u32 delay;
-	unsigned long timeout;
-
 	if (!host->cfg->can_calibrate)
 		return 0;
 
-	reg &= ~(SDXC_CAL_DL_MASK << SDXC_CAL_DL_SW_SHIFT);
-	reg &= ~SDXC_CAL_DL_SW_EN;
-
-	writel(reg | SDXC_CAL_START, host->reg_base + reg_off);
-
-	dev_dbg(mmc_dev(host->mmc), "calibration started\n");
-
-	timeout = jiffies + HZ * SDXC_CAL_TIMEOUT;
-
-	while (!((reg = readl(host->reg_base + reg_off)) & SDXC_CAL_DONE)) {
-		if (time_before(jiffies, timeout))
-			cpu_relax();
-		else {
-			reg &= ~SDXC_CAL_START;
-			writel(reg, host->reg_base + reg_off);
-
-			return -ETIMEDOUT;
-		}
-	}
-
-	delay = (reg >> SDXC_CAL_DL_SHIFT) & SDXC_CAL_DL_MASK;
-
-	reg &= ~SDXC_CAL_START;
-	reg |= (delay << SDXC_CAL_DL_SW_SHIFT) | SDXC_CAL_DL_SW_EN;
-
-	writel(reg, host->reg_base + reg_off);
-
-	dev_dbg(mmc_dev(host->mmc), "calibration ended, reg is 0x%x\n", reg);
+	/*
+	 * FIXME:
+	 * This is not clear how the calibration is supposed to work
+	 * yet. The best rate have been obtained by simply setting the
+	 * delay to 0, as Allwinner does in its BSP.
+	 *
+	 * The only mode that doesn't have such a delay is HS400, that
+	 * is in itself a TODO.
+	 */
+	writel(SDXC_CAL_DL_SW_EN, host->reg_base + reg_off);
 
 	return 0;
 }
@@ -809,7 +787,13 @@ static int sunxi_mmc_clk_set_rate(struct sunxi_mmc_host *host,
 	if (ret)
 		return ret;
 
-	/* TODO: enable calibrate on sdc2 SDXC_REG_DS_DL_REG of A64 */
+	/*
+	 * FIXME:
+	 *
+	 * In HS400 we'll also need to calibrate the data strobe
+	 * signal. This should only happen on the MMC2 controller (at
+	 * least on the A64).
+	 */
 
 	return sunxi_mmc_oclk_onoff(host, 1);
 }

* [PATCH v5 4/13] mmc: sunxi: Enable the new timings for the A64 MMC controllers
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

The A64 MMC controllers need to set a "new timings" bit when a new rate is
set.

The actual meaning of that bit is not clear yet, but not setting it leads
to some corner-case issues, like the CMD53 failing, which is used to
implement SDIO packet aggregation.

Signed-off-by: Maxime Ripard <maxime.ripard@free-electrons.com>
Tested-by: Florian Vaussard <florian.vaussard@heig-vd.ch>
---
 drivers/mmc/host/sunxi-mmc.c | 6 ++++++
 1 file changed, 6 insertions(+), 0 deletions(-)

diff --git a/drivers/mmc/host/sunxi-mmc.c b/drivers/mmc/host/sunxi-mmc.c
index b9c8a62bc212..51d6388a194e 100644
--- a/drivers/mmc/host/sunxi-mmc.c
+++ b/drivers/mmc/host/sunxi-mmc.c
@@ -253,6 +253,8 @@ struct sunxi_mmc_cfg {
 
 	/* does the IP block support autocalibration? */
 	bool can_calibrate;
+
+	bool needs_new_timings;
 };
 
 struct sunxi_mmc_host {
@@ -779,6 +781,9 @@ static int sunxi_mmc_clk_set_rate(struct sunxi_mmc_host *host,
 	}
 	mmc_writel(host, REG_CLKCR, rval);
 
+	if (host->cfg->needs_new_timings)
+		mmc_writel(host, REG_SD_NTSR, SDXC_2X_TIMING_MODE);
+
 	ret = sunxi_mmc_clk_set_phase(host, ios, rate);
 	if (ret)
 		return ret;
@@ -1076,6 +1081,7 @@ static const struct sunxi_mmc_cfg sun50i_a64_cfg = {
 	.idma_des_size_bits = 16,
 	.clk_delays = NULL,
 	.can_calibrate = true,
+	.needs_new_timings = true,
 };
 
 static const struct of_device_id sunxi_mmc_of_match[] = {

* [PATCH v5 5/13] mmc: sunxi: Mask DATA0 when updating the clock
  2017-01-27 21:38 ` Maxime Ripard
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

The A64 MMC controllers need DATA0 to be masked while updating the clock,
otherwise any subsequent command will result in a timeout.

It's not really clear at this point what DATA0 is exactly, but this
behaviour is present in Allwinner's tree, and has been suggested by
Allwinner engineers as fixes for the timeout.

Signed-off-by: Maxime Ripard <maxime.ripard@free-electrons.com>
Tested-by: Florian Vaussard <florian.vaussard@heig-vd.ch>
---
 drivers/mmc/host/sunxi-mmc.c | 14 +++++++++++++-
 1 file changed, 13 insertions(+), 1 deletion(-)

diff --git a/drivers/mmc/host/sunxi-mmc.c b/drivers/mmc/host/sunxi-mmc.c
index 51d6388a194e..6bbe61397b7c 100644
--- a/drivers/mmc/host/sunxi-mmc.c
+++ b/drivers/mmc/host/sunxi-mmc.c
@@ -101,6 +101,7 @@
 	(SDXC_SOFT_RESET | SDXC_FIFO_RESET | SDXC_DMA_RESET)
 
 /* clock control bits */
+#define SDXC_MASK_DATA0			BIT(31)
 #define SDXC_CARD_CLOCK_ON		BIT(16)
 #define SDXC_LOW_POWER_ON		BIT(17)
 
@@ -254,6 +255,9 @@ struct sunxi_mmc_cfg {
 	/* does the IP block support autocalibration? */
 	bool can_calibrate;
 
+	/* Does DATA0 needs to be masked while the clock is updated */
+	bool mask_data0;
+
 	bool needs_new_timings;
 };
 
@@ -657,10 +661,12 @@ static int sunxi_mmc_oclk_onoff(struct sunxi_mmc_host *host, u32 oclk_en)
 	u32 rval;
 
 	rval = mmc_readl(host, REG_CLKCR);
-	rval &= ~(SDXC_CARD_CLOCK_ON | SDXC_LOW_POWER_ON);
+	rval &= ~(SDXC_CARD_CLOCK_ON | SDXC_LOW_POWER_ON | SDXC_MASK_DATA0);
 
 	if (oclk_en)
 		rval |= SDXC_CARD_CLOCK_ON;
+	if (host->cfg->mask_data0)
+		rval |= SDXC_MASK_DATA0;
 
 	mmc_writel(host, REG_CLKCR, rval);
 
@@ -680,6 +686,11 @@ static int sunxi_mmc_oclk_onoff(struct sunxi_mmc_host *host, u32 oclk_en)
 		return -EIO;
 	}
 
+	if (host->cfg->mask_data0) {
+		rval = mmc_readl(host, REG_CLKCR);
+		mmc_writel(host, REG_CLKCR, rval & ~SDXC_MASK_DATA0);
+	}
+
 	return 0;
 }
 
@@ -1081,6 +1092,7 @@ static const struct sunxi_mmc_cfg sun50i_a64_cfg = {
 	.idma_des_size_bits = 16,
 	.clk_delays = NULL,
 	.can_calibrate = true,
+	.mask_data0 = true,
 	.needs_new_timings = true,
 };

* [PATCH v5 6/13] mmc: sunxi: Add EMMC (MMC2) controller compatible
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

The MMC2 controller on the A64 is kind of a special beast.

While the general controller design is the same than the other MMC
controllers in the SoC, it also has a bunch of features and changes that
prevent it to be driven in the same way.

It has for example a different bus width limit, a different maximum
frequency, and, for some reason, the maximum buffer size of a DMA
descriptor.

Add a new compatible specifically for this controller.

* [PATCH v5 8/13] arm64: allwinner: a64: Add MMC nodes
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

From: Andre Przywara <andre.przywara@arm.com>

The A64 has 3 MMC controllers, one of them being especially targeted to
eMMC. Among other things, it has a data strobe signal and a 8 bits data
width.

The two other are more usual controllers that will have a 4 bits width at
most and no data strobe signal, which limits it to more usual SD or MMC
peripherals.

* [PATCH v5 10/13] arm64: allwinner: a64: Increase the MMC max frequency
  2017-01-27 21:38 ` Maxime Ripard
  (?)
@ 2017-01-27 21:38   ` Maxime Ripard
  -1 siblings, 0 replies; 56+ messages in thread
From: Maxime Ripard @ 2017-01-27 21:38 UTC (permalink / raw)
  To: Chen-Yu Tsai, Maxime Ripard, Ulf Hansson
  Cc: Rob Herring, devicetree, linux-arm-kernel, linux-kernel,
	linux-mmc, Andre Przywara

The eMMC controller seem to have a maximum frequency of 200MHz, while the
regular MMC controllers are capped at 150MHz.

Since older SoCs cannot go that high, we cannot change the default maximum
frequency, but fortunately for us we have a property for that in the DT.

This also has the side effect of allowing to use the MMC HS200 and SD
SDR104 modes for the boards that support it (with either 1.2v or 1.8v IOs).
